The Renowned Hideo Kojima and AI
Hideo Kojima, the visionary game designer behind iconic titles such as Metal Gear Solid and Death Stranding, has never been one to shy away from sharing his thoughts on the intersection of technology and art. In a recent statement that has caught the attention of fans and industry experts alike, Kojima expressed his disinterest in artificial intelligence, despite acknowledging its potential to create art. This revelation came during his appearance in an AI-generated promotional video for a new art exhibit, sparking discussions about the role of AI in creative processes.
An Insight into Kojima's Stance on AI
Speaking about his thoughts on AI and its capabilities in the realm of art, Kojima offered a nuanced perspective. While acknowledging the theoretical possibility of AI being able to create art, he emphasized his belief that his own presence as a creator is indispensable to the artistic process. Kojima's statement reflects his deep connection to his work and a commitment to the human element in creative endeavors.
